A chunky handwritten script with rounded terminals and a brush-pen feel. Strokes are mostly monoline with subtle swelling in curves, giving a soft, inked texture without sharp calligraphic contrast. Letterforms are compact and slightly bouncy, with varied character widths and gently irregular curves that keep an organic rhythm. Lowercase shows frequent joins and looped forms, while uppercase reads as simplified, hand-drawn capitals that sit comfortably alongside the script lowercase.
Well-suited to short-to-medium display text where a friendly, handcrafted voice is desired—logos, product labels, café/retail signage, posters, and social graphics. The bold, rounded strokes help it hold up on screen and in print, especially at headline sizes.
The overall tone is warm and informal, suggesting quick, confident marker lettering. It feels approachable and cheerful, with enough heft to read clearly while retaining a personal, handwritten character.
Designed to mimic relaxed brush handwriting with clean, consistent construction, balancing legibility with an expressive, personal rhythm. The goal appears to be an easygoing script that can add warmth and personality to modern display typography.
Counters are generally open and rounded, and many letters use soft entry/exit strokes that create a natural flow in words. Numerals match the handwritten style with simple shapes and consistent weight, suitable for casual display settings.
